//[Authorize(Roles = "Applicant")] public ActionResult ApplyForCourse(int universityId, string course) { NAAWeb.Services.Service.NAAWebService naaWebService = new NAAWeb.Services.Service.NAAWebService(); if (naaWebService.GetCoursesByUniversityId(universityId) == null) { return(RedirectToAction("UnderConstruction", new { Controller = "NAAWebService" })); } else { List <SelectListItem> listOfCourses = new List <SelectListItem>(); IList <UniversityBEAN> theCourses = naaWebService.GetCoursesByUniversityId(universityId); foreach (var item in theCourses) { listOfCourses.Add( new SelectListItem() { Text = item.Name, Value = item.Name }); } ViewBag.listOfCourses = listOfCourses; string uid = User.Identity.GetUserId(); ApplicationBEAN newApplication = new ApplicationBEAN(); newApplication.CourseName = course; newApplication.UniversityId = universityId; return(View(newApplication)); } }
public NAAWebServiceController() { nAAWebServices = new NAAWeb.Services.Service.NAAWebService(); }